Tips on Losing Weight For New Moms

The journey through pregnancy to delivery puts your body through transformations that you probably watched with mixed emotions. While it is thrilling to see the signs of new life kicking below the surface, at the same time you probably have been scheming all along on how you’ll eventually lose that extra weight. If you’re not sure how to begin, here are a few tips on things you can do to work back to your pre-pregnancy body (or even better).

1.    Go For a Walk

Your body has been through a lot, it is very normal to stay away from serious exercise for up to 6 weeks or longer if you had a Cesarean section. Once you feel rested enough to begin an exercise program, begin simply by taking a walk around the block. You don’t have to go far, it is reported that pushing a stroller 1 to 2 miles actually burns about 150 calories.

2.    Get strong, lift weights

As a new mother you know very well that you don’t have to go to the gym to lift weights. You’re doing it all the time every day! Use your new baby’s weight by holding the baby to your chest while you do lunges. You can also get a great workout by holding the baby above your chest  and slowly pressing her toward the ceiling several times.

3.    Increase lean muscle, take protein

One of the best ways to lose weight is to build lean muscle. When you create lean muscle, your body burns large amounts of calories. Calories are constantly burned to maintain that lean muscle as well. This is a great benefit because you can basically increase your metabolism simply by increasing the lean muscle in your body. Protein is the essential requirement in this process.  Whey Protein in particular is an excellent source to help your body create lean muscle. It is actually a product of the process of making milk (something you should know about by now!) and is an all-natural way to boost your daily protein diet. It is safe, inexpensive, and very effective. The second most abundant component in whey protein is alpha-lactalbumin, which is one of the primary whey proteins in human breast milk.

4.    Breastfeeding

Although breastfeeding requires that you add 500 calories to your diet, just by breastfeeding you actually burn 600 to 800 calories a day. So just by feeding your baby you can actually lose weight. Some lucky women will actually lose all of their baby fat by breastfeeding alone!

5.    Watch calories, avoid fat

You will have to be disciplined and stay away from empty calories found in soda and chips. Healthy nutrient-rich foods like fresh fruit and vegetables, low-fat dairy, and whole grains will definitely help you to lose weight and feel great. Experts discourage dieting right after giving birth, you need to think about the repairing process that your body is experiencing at this stage. Eat small, frequent meals, don’t skip meals, and be sure to distribute calories throughout the day. This will ensure that you won’t overeat and will best metabolize the calories in your diet.

Which protein shake is the best to grow muscles and mass on the body?

I am 16 years old. I am working out in gym. I am a bit skinny but tall. I have been working on my muscles for a long time and i can see a bit of my abs but my biceps, chest, and triceps are not growing. The problem is i want to grow muscles like people say that no one can say that you are working out ... Some of my friends told me to buy ISO MASS protein shake. Now which shake is best for me. I weight like 135lbs and 62 kg ....... is there any side effects on using ISO MASS????? please please please help me out

I am working on my biceps , chests and abs like pretty much upper body. but i dont wanna goo buff like Ronnie COleman .....
sorry didn't mentioned that i need to build muscles too not only mass like a fat ass like big looking and mass too get it

ok theres 2 different products:

whey protein
mass gainer

do not mix up the 2 although they are similar they have to completely different roles, your friends are telling you to buy a mass gainer which is basically a protein shake with lots of calories and i mean lots, it contians carbs and abit more protein than whey protien but the serving sizes are huuge.

now whey protein contians about 20g of protein per serving and is only about 100 calories when taken with water, it will help keep you lean, personally i would recommend you buy whey protein as mass gainers just make you fat and many people make the mistake of thinking fat gives you more muscle which is not true it is a myth. so i wouldnt recommend a mass gainer.

remember this all supplements are pretty much the same all you really need to pay attention to is their price and the amount of protein per servings, how many servings in a tub, pretty much all whey proteins are the same and have slight differences other than taste, make the decision what you want form a product and compare them they have alot of information on the packaging about their protein content.
